Stand-up comedy(脱口秀)is becoming popular with young people in China. One person stands in front of people and tells something funny that happened to them. They will try their best to make people laugh.
A stand-up comedian (脱口秀演员) is different from an actor. An actor usually has a team of other actors to work with. However, a stand-up comedian's success depends on his or her own. It usually takes days or even weeks of hard work to make people laugh for a few minutes.
Stand-up comedy has many different kinds. It can include a story on funny things. It can be just several jokes. The comedian can start his or her show almost anywhere——clubs, bars or parties.
Stand-up comedy has come a long way in the West, but it is new in China. Today the most popular stand-up comedy show in China is Rock & Roast (《脱口秀大会》). All of its four seasons were popular. When the first season came out, it soon became one of the hottest TV shows in China.The show is such a big success that it has opened a new door to stand-up comedians. More and more young people have begun watching stand-up comedy. And some of them even start doing it as a full-time job. They say it's a great way to relax.

Now more people have to work indoors with computers. This means much sitting and little exercise. We have known that if we don't move much, we will get fatter, we will have heart problems and maybe we will get diabetes(糖尿病). But new studies have shown that it could hurt our mental (精神的) health too.
A study of 937 Brazilian adults found that about one-third of them sat for more than 10 hours per day. It reported that people who sat for too long often showed more symptoms(症状) of depression (抑郁) .
Another study was centered on children. It found that each extra hour of sitting time at the age of 12, 14 and 16 led to higher depression points at age 18.
But according to Mats Hallgren from Sweden,“Sitting for too long can slow the blood flow(流动) in the body, including the blood flow to the head.”It might be bad for the growth of neurons(神经细胞) in the head. Besides, couch potatoes might do other unhealthy things while sitting, such as eating junk food. All of these may lead to depression.
The good news It's easy to control. Aaron Kandola from University College London, said even light exercise might help.“It is great to exercise and play sports.”said Kandola. But anything you can do to avoid sitting for too long will help with moods(心情), stress and thinking clearly. The key is just to move more often.
